在当前互联网的环境下,越来越多的网站选择了云服务器(Elastic Cloud Server, ECS)作为其服务器托管商。随着云计算技术的发展和普及,云服务器成为目前最热门的服务器托管方式之一。但是,有很多人往往会问一个问题:云服务器能建几个站?
这个问题并不是一个简单的数字问题,而是一个相对复杂的问题。
首先,云服务器的性能取决于其套餐和配置。可以选择不同的配置以满足不同的应用需求。例如,若需要承载多个网站和流量,需要选择更高配置的云服务器。通常,ECS服务器的单核心CPU可以承载数十个网站,但实际上并不能单纯地通过CPU核心数量来计算具体能承载多少网站。
其次,服务器的硬盘空间和访问量也是关键因素。网站所需的磁盘空间和访问量不同,这也会影响云服务器承载的网站数量。一般情况下,云服务器硬盘空间越大,承载网站的数量也会相应增加。
另外,云服务器还受到服务器软件的限制。目前,常见的云服务器软件有Apache和Nginx。不同的服务器软件在服务器上承载网站时,表现也会不一样。 在这里,我们将以Nginx为例来讨论云服务器能承载多少个站点。
首先,了解一下Nginx的工作方式:Nginx使用多进程和异步机制处理请求,能够高效地处理大量并发请求。因此,在一个CPU核心下,Nginx理论上可承载更多的站点。
然而,同样的服务器配置和性能,不同的网站类型的表现也会不同。如果所有的站点都是静态页面,那么一个Web服务进程可以处理的请求数就多了,每个进程需要的资源的分配也小一些。因此在这种情况下,一台服务器上能承载更多的站点。
而如果站点有大量读写操作、或者需要动态网页服务,单个Web服务进程能处理的请求数就会少一些,每个进程分配给站点的资源也会更多。此时,一台服务器上承载的站点数将会有所降低。
另一个要考虑的因素是网站访问量。如果你的网站每天有数百万的访问量,那么一台服务器可以承载的网站数就得减少,甚至需要使用多台服务器。反之,如果你的网站每天只有几千或几万的访问量,一台云服务器就可以承载更多的网站。
综上所述,云服务器能建几个站点这个问题并没有一个明确的答案。可以基于云服务器配置,软件以及站点的特点来确定一个相对合理的承载量。但我们可以提供一些建议:
1.选择适合自己网站需求的云服务器套餐和配置,例如CPU核心数、内存、硬盘等等。
2.为站点选择适合的服务器软件,例如Nginx。
3.根据站点类型和访问量进行合理的站点规划和分配。
4.定期对服务器进行性能监控和优化,以确保服务器稳定运行。
总之,云服务器能建几个站点这个问题的答案不是唯一的,而需要根据实际需求和服务器性能来确定。我们希望本文可以为建站者提供一些指导,帮助您更好地规划和运营自己的网站。
转转请注明出处:https://www.yunxiaoer.com/111398.html